Overview of Thymulin: Biochemical Structure and Mechanisms

Thymulin is a naturally occurring thymic nonapeptide hormone composed of nine amino acid residues (Glu-Gln-Lys-Gly-Ser-Ser-Gln-Gly-Ser). In its biologically active state, the peptide forms a complex with a zinc ion ($Zn^{2+}$), which induces a specific conformational state required for biological signaling.

Preclinical studies indicate that Thymulin plays a crucial role in immune system regulation, specifically modulating T-cell differentiation and enhancing suppressor and cytotoxic T-cell function in cellular models. Research published in immunopharmacology literature highlights its involvement in thymic factor activity within cellular signaling pathways.

How to Vet a Peptide Supplier: Red Flags in Research Biochemicals

Selecting a reliable reagent vendor requires careful evaluation beyond superficial marketing claims. When vetting peptide vendors for your Madison laboratory, watch for several critical operational red flags:

1. Missing or Generic COAs: Reputable vendors provide lot-specific COAs featuring raw HPLC chromatograms and Mass Spec data, rather than static sample reports.

2. Lack of Endotoxin Testing: For cell culture and delicate assays, unverified bacterial endotoxin levels can invalidate experimental outcomes.

3. Deceptive Local Presence Claims: Beware of online vendors claiming to operate local retail stores or physical chemical storefronts in Madison when they are merely dropshipping unverified material from overseas.

4. Non-Specific Synthesis Standards: Vendors that refuse to detail their purification processes or lyophilization protocols often trade in low-purity, crude mixtures.

Temperature Sensitivity and Cold-Chain Considerations for Wisconsin Winters

Wisconsin climate conditions vary drastically throughout the year, ranging from hot, humid summers to sub-zero winter temperatures in Madison. Lyophilized (freeze-dried) peptides like Thymulin demonstrate high thermal stability during short-term transit, provided they remain sealed in desiccated, nitrogen-flushed vials.

During extreme Midwest winter months, exposure to repeated freeze-thaw cycles prior to reconstitution is prevented by our protective, insulated packaging. Once received by your laboratory, lyophilized vials should be stored at -20°C or -80°C for long-term stability.

For reconstituted working solutions, researchers should use sterile, buffered solutions (such as bacteriostatic water or PBS) and aliquot into single-use volumes to maintain biological activity over time.
